What Is A Complex Chronic Health Condition? 

Each person will have their unique presentation, but often these conditions will involve a web of symptoms that can include any combination of chronic pain, migraines or headaches, extreme fatigue, concentration issues, memory loss, IBS or bowel irregularities, food allergies or sensitivities, insomnia, sensitivity to light or smells, mood swings, and any number of other strange symptoms. 

Complex and chronic health conditions can come in many shapes and sizes, but they will often share similarities, such as:

  • Difficult to diagnose and poorly understood

  • Standard medical treatments are limited, often with unwanted potential side-effects

  • Affect multiple body systems simultaneously

  • Involve a web of symptoms that  prevent you from fully engaging with life

  • Can be invisible from the outside so that people may not realise something is wrong

For some, you may be trying to get to the bottom of what’s going on with your body, but after doing the rounds of tests and specialists, still have no clear diagnosis or solutions. 

For others, you may have already received a diagnosis (or several), but have found this label has not come with the help you need to truly heal and start feeling better. Sometimes the diagnosis becomes our cage.

Complex chronic conditions fall under labels such as:

  • Autoimmune conditions in all of their manifestations

  • Fibromyalgia

  • Chronic Fatigue Syndrome (CFS) or Myalgic Encephalomyelitis (ME)

  • Post-viral syndromes

  • Lyme disease

  • Toxicity from mould, heavy metals or other toxins

  • Mystery illnesses with no diagnosis

A Different Approach To Complex Chronic Conditions

  • Each Person Is Unique

I’ve learned a lot from my own experience having been diagnosed with two autoimmune conditions, and I continue to study and research in the hope to better guide others through the tangled maze of regaining their health.

 

The first important thing to understand when addressing these issues, is that each person has their own unique internal ecosystem. This ecosystem can get out of balance and dysregulated from a variety of causes. Once imbalanced, this becomes holding patterns that keep a person in these patterns of illness. 

 

Just because two people have fibromyalgia, does not mean that the same treatment or advice is appropriate for both of them. We have to treat a person as a whole person and what’s going on for them, not just as a diagnosis or set of symptoms.

  • Timing Is Important

The second important thing to understand is timing. When things are complex and multiple systems are affected simultaneously, it helps to have an order of operations to what we do in treatments and what advice is given, as well as realistic expectations around how long things can take to change.

 

Timing is a largely overlooked part of healing - the best treatment at the wrong time, is still the wrong treatment. Based on Chinese medicine theory, I utilise a 4-5 stage model to help us navigate your healing journey:

  Stage 1. Immune system

  Stage 2.  Gut microbiome

  Stage 3. Nervous system

  Stage 4. Blood circulation

  Stage 5. Supplementation (if needed)

It’s not always a linear progression for everyone and there are overlaps between stages, but it helps us to match the appropriate treatments and advice according to where you’re at. 

I wish I had this framework at the beginning of my own journey. Since learning it, making sense of all of the different treatments and approaches out there, and where/when they might fit in, has become much easier.

If we do things out of order like focusing too much on supplementation when there is gut dysbiosis, we may just end up feeding the harmful gut bugs. Or if we focus too much on physical exercise when there are lingering pathogens that our immune system is struggling with, you will probably just end up feeling more sick and tired.
